Beschreibung:

A GROUP OF EIGHT EARLY ISLAMIC GLASS VESSELS 7TH-12TH CENTURY A.D. Comprising a clear glass flask with hexagonal-sided body and cylindrical neck, mounted, 3.1/8 in. (8 cm.) high; a translucent glass bowl with rosettes within ovals on the exterior, repaired, both 7th-9th Century A.D.; a brown glass flask with cylindrical body and conical mouth with bulb at base of neck, 8th-9th Century A.D., 4.1/8 in. (10.5 cm.) high; a clear glass bulbous flask with cylindrical faceted neck, iridescent, repaired, 8th-10th Century A.D., 2.3/8 in. (96 cm.) high; a heavy green glass flask, the cylindrical body with moulded diagonal basket weave pattern and short neck, 3¼ in. (8.2 cm.) high; another flask, similar, 3.5/8 in. (9.2 cm.) high, both 10th-11th Century A.D.; a green glass flask with conical neck and squat body moulded with two rows of concentric circles and ovals, repaired; and a green glass amphoriskos with twin handles, the conical body with relief diamonds and scrolling volutes, both iridescent, 11th-12th Century A.D., 4.1/8 in. (10.5 cm.) high max. (8)
